Apex - Horizontal Multistage Pumps
Apex multistage pumps are specifically designed for operation in buildings, with virtually no noise or vibration. Horizontal units are supplied complete with bedplate, coupling, guard and electric motor. Diesel driven units can also be supplied. The multistage design, using several impellers in series, generates high pressure from the pump while running at low speed for quiet operation. Capable of handling clean water, seawater and other liquids with similar properties.

Apex - Vertical Trunk Pumps
The Apex Pumps TVL range of pumps are vertical trunk pumps for mounting into a tank, pit or sump. The pumps can be designed to fit onto any tank top forming part of the lid. The shaft is supported by a thrust bearing at the top of the shaft and by a product lubricated synthetic sleeve bearing adjacent to the impeller with further lubricated line shaft bearings as required.
